## Break-Glass Access: Broker Upgrade (Tollgate)

For the weekly sync: the Tollgate message broker upgrade to v9 requires draining all queues first. If consumers stall mid-drain and the admin credentials rotate out, break-glass access is the only path back in. Log the incident, get one peer approval, and document queue depths before unsealing. The recovery passphrase for the break-glass vault appears below.

strongbox words: istwyn-wenmir-eliox-gorir

## Authentication

Heads up: the nightly reindex job (`reindex_nightly.py`) talks to the Lanternfish search cluster, and that cluster won't accept anonymous writes anymore — we locked it down last sprint. The job now authenticates as the `reindex-runner` service identity against Corvid Gateway, and the token is injected via the `LF_INDEX_TOKEN` env var in the scheduler config. Nothing clever going on, just a bearer header on every batch request. For review purposes, the staging credential currently in use is listed below.

service key, kadug-kadup: kto15_rN23XLAYImmZgrJ

## Deploying the Gatewick Proctor Queue

Deploys are pretty painless: push to main, wait for the pipeline, then watch the queue drain dashboard for five minutes. If candidates pile up mid-exam, roll back first and ask questions later — the queue replays safely. Everything the workers care about lives in one config block, shown here for reference.

settings of bafof-yagef:
JOROX_PIN=8740
JOROX_TENANT=pelox
JOROX_METRICS_HOST=metrics.jorox.qorvelworks.internal
JOROX_SEAL=seal_c78f63c1
JOROX_STANDBY_TEAM=norax

## Break-Glass Access — Snapshot Testing

If the Plumeline snapshot suite blocks a release and the owner is unreachable, release managers may bypass via break-glass. Regenerate snapshots only for the flagged components, attach diffs to the ticket, and notify the Orvane UI guild within one hour. Unlock the bypass vault with the passphrase below.

recovery phrase for bawep-kawef: oliath-casdor